Abstract
Nanomembranes are natural or artificial structures that have a thickness of less than
100 nm. These particles, as their name suggests, originated from the science of
nanotechnology, and it is a branch of this science that has attracted the most attention
among them; These particles show innovative and better physical, chemical, and
biological properties.
A nanomembrane may be any membrane if it consists of a nanostructured material.
Nanomembranes have special features such as extremely high surface area to weight
ratio, low density, high pore volume, small pore size, stiffness, and higher tensile
strength compared to conventional fibers, which have made these materials used in
a wide variety of fields.
Nanomembranes have various applications including energy harvesting, sensing,
optics, plasmonics, and biomedicine. Also, the fibers prepared with this technology called composite nanofibers are suitable for bio-based technology, textiles, filters,
and sensors, and one of the advantages of these materials is that due to their
properties, they can perform multiple tasks simultaneously. It is economical in the
industrial dimension as well.
